Understand Ingredient Performance Before Production

The Rapid Visco® Analyser (RVA) acts like a miniature pilot plant for your ingredients. It simulates real cooking and processing conditions to show how materials behave in real time.

Used across research, product development and production, the RVA helps you select the right raw materials, optimise processes, reduce waste, and ensure consistent product quality.

Why should you choose the RVA?

NIR Icons-01 2.png

The industry standard for ingredient funcionality: The Rapid Visco® Analyser is widely recognized as the reference tool for measuring how ingredients behave during processing. Used across academia and industry, it delivers reliable and comparable results.

NIR Icons-04 2.png

Proven applications across food categories: With over 50 established methods, the RVA supports testing across starch, pasta, noodles, dairy and more. Methods can be used directly or adapted to match your specific processes.

image 154.png

Globally recognized methods: ICC, AACC and GB/T approved methods ensure results are consistent, comparable and accepted worldwide.
